To enjoy Cheater's Table, an entry-level GPU such as the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is sufficient for running the game at the minimum requirements. This makes the title highly accessible for gamers with budget systems. The casual nature of the game and its simple graphics mean that it won't be demanding on your hardware, allowing for smooth gameplay even on modest setups.

For those with mid-range GPUs, like the GTX 1660 or RX 6600, you can expect to play at 1080p with higher settings, providing a more vivid experience without compromising performance. High-end GPUs will enable 1440p or even 4K resolutions, although the game’s visuals are not particularly demanding, so the focus here would be more on frame rates rather than graphical fidelity. Overall, this title is well-suited for a wide range of hardware, making it a great choice for casual gamers looking for a fun and engaging card game experience.
